This isn't so much about a celebrity, but about a site covering celebrities... namely. TMZ. They ran a story about ex-Bachelor Andy Baldwin's latest assignment - looking for the human remains of a WW2-era bomber crew. Unfortunately, they weren't exactly all that happy about it. Actual article follows:

"Bachelor" On Hunt For Human Remains - TMZ.com - Entertainment News, Celebrity Gossip and Hollywood Rumors

Quote:
"Bachelor" On Hunt For Human Remains
Posted Mar 20th 2008 10:01PM by TMZ Staff

Former "Bachelor" bachelor Andy Baldwin just got back from the island of Palau in the South Pacific -- not on vacation, on a mission with the Navy. Now let's talk about why we the taxpayers are footing the bill on such BS.

Baldwin was among 20 military types who were on a search mission in the middle of the ocean. What, you ask, were they looking for? A B-24J bomber that went down during the war. Not Iraq. Not Vietnam. No, not Korea. We're talking WWII, as in more than 60 years ago.

Turns out, the military spends $52 million each year to find the remains of missing soldiers -- it's part of the POW/MIA program. That's all well and good depending on the circumstances. But a crash that is ancient history, at a time when the economy sucks and the Federal government is sucking the life out of everyone with taxes??


Baldwin, a Navy medic and diver, and crew found what could be human remains. We're told it's all being tested in the lab and it could take months, even years, to determine identities. At least he got a really good tan.
Let's just say it didn't go over too well. 26 pages of comments, at 15 each... that's at least 375 comments. And almost all of them are furious at TMZ.

Sounds like it's official.
Nashville, Tennessee - Nashville Area News - Tennessean.com
Quote:
Pamela Anderson's marriage nears end

LOS ANGELES (AP) -- Pamela Anderson's new husband - apparently a specialist in short relationships with celebrities - agrees that their two-month marriage should be voided, according to court papers filed Friday.

Rick Salomon agrees in papers responding to a filing by the "Baywatch" actress that the marriage should be annulled because of fraud, though neither set of documents elaborated.

Salomon did not ask for spousal support and asked that it not be awarded to Anderson.

A phone message left for Anderson's publicist was not immediately returned Friday.

Salomon is known for making a sex videotape with then-girlfriend Paris Hilton and was previously married to actress Shannen Doherty for nine months.

He and Anderson were married Oct. 6 in Las Vegas and separated Dec. 13.

Anderson, 40, was previously married to singer Kid Rock and Motley Crue drummer Tommy Lee.
